bubble burst could be heading our way. >> well there is definitely a real sense of fear that is out there and when fear is there and the opposite of optimism then certainly venture capitalists are going to put the brakes on and go slower and lend less money. >> lay offs and the extreme fall of tech stocks is spooking investors. linked in stock is 50% down from where it was in november. twitter stock is down 62% over the last year. >> twitter is in big trouble laying off 8% of their work force. for the first time they are not gaining users they are losing people. in the last three months they lost 2 million users. yahoo also in really bad shape announcing laying off 50% of their work force around 1700 people. hp has laid off 33,000 and microsoft has laid off 7,800.
4:42 am
smaller high-tech companies are feeling it. go pro, instagram and yelp also. >> a different event happening and growth as before in 2016. >> josh schwartz wrote this article for u.s.a. today about how the hour of reckoning is coming for tech. >> you are going to see more belt tightening than we have before. it's not going to be the unbridled growth that has been dominating for so long. >> it's not going to be a bubble pop but it is a slow down and people are losing their jobs and companies aren't hiring as aggressively as they were before so it's a definitely change. >> john and other tech analysts say there will not be a fierce bubble pop but a slow down. lessons were learned and things are different now. >> now you have a much larger
4:43 am
audience on line. 3billion people versus half a million back then. you have a lot more real profitable businesses. the mobile phone revolution the use of that has led to a really strong internet economy. all i'm saying is what you are going to see is scaling back of what's been going on which was not sustainable to begin with. >> our lessons learned some yes some no. i have absolutely no faith that everybody is going to say well we've learned so much the last time and we are not going to go down that path again. that's not necessarily true but people remember what it was like when jobs were scarce. >> and they need to be prepared for jobs being scarce so from what i learned unless there's another major terrorist attack or a foreign market collapsing there will not be a dramatic bubble pop with a different company closing it's doors every day but it will effect the job market, lay offs will continue and it will be harder to keep one you already have.

5:26 the time. getting enough sleep is crucial of course but more than a third of us don't get enough. people need at least 7 hours of sleep a night. no new groundbreaking news there but research shows the less sleep you get the more risk you have for obesity, diabetes, heart disease and mental illness so try to stick to a schedule. that's tip number one. also go to bed and wake up at the same time each day including the weekends. also keep your room dark and turn the thermostat down. you tend to sleep better when you are cooler.
5:27 am
also get rid of the electronics. try not to keep them by your bed. before bed don't eat a big meal, don't drink caffeine or alcohol and during the day try to exercise. that will make you exhausted by bed time. there could be another problem that's preventing good sleep so check that out. annie. >> tracking another warm day across the bay area james. livermore warming up into the mid 70s by later this afternoon with light winds. right now at 45 degrees so grab a jacket as you head out the door but don't forget your sunglasses and sun screen. two bay area high schools what security measures are being put in place to keep your kids safe. all that coming up.

commute. today we will find out how well californians are saving water in this drought. state water reg litters will release the latest water use numbers for last month. january is the 8th month of mandatory conversation. last year the government required nerve our state to use 25% less water. in december, california's used 18% less, falling short of the target for a third straight month. the conservation orders have been extended through october, depending on whether them el nino storms will then ease the drought, and so far not so good. oakland police arrest a third person in connection to two robberies at the stone rich mall in pleasantton. the first two suspects were arrested by oakland p.d. back on tuesday. the suspects first attacked a girl as she left the mall last weekend, and then on sunday, a woman in her 60s was robbed at gunpoint for her purse.

6:42. warning if your kids use social media, and everyone does. a man is accused of stealing from college students and using instagram to track down victims. police say that arturo targeted 33 women who were students at a university, and police say that he would see the victims in public, usually at a coffee shop or mall, and then would try to track their locations through instagram, and got their home addresses from the geotagged photos on there, and then he stole over $200,000 worth of items they say, including laptops, jewelry, underwear.
6:43 am
